Listen, Manage, Learn: This Is How We Address Your Concerns at IDB Invest

The Management Grievance Mechanism serves individuals, communities, and groups seeking to voice their concerns on environmental or social issues related to projects financed or under consideration.

The Management Grievance Mechanism is integral to IDB Invest’s commitment to transparency and accountability. 

It provides a structured process for addressing grievances, ensuring that all complaints are handled with due consideration and care. 

This mechanism's design complements IDB Invest’s broader agenda of fostering sustainable and responsible project development.

Key Benefits

  1. Problem Solving: It acts as a direct communication channel between communities and project stakeholders. By focusing on dialogue and trust-building, it seeks timely and effective solutions to the concerns raised. This often involves coordinating with clients and finding creative alternatives to address issues, ensuring that communities remain at the heart of the solution process.
  2. Risk Management: As an early warning tool, the mechanism helps identify and mitigate risks before they escalate. This proactive approach strengthens projects' environmental and social performance, consolidating clients’ in-house grievance mechanisms and enhancing risk awareness throughout the project cycle.
  3. Continuous Learning: The mechanism also provides a platform for continuous learning by listening to project stakeholders. This helps in understanding the experiences of project beneficiaries and identifying broader trends and systemic issues. The insights gained are integrated back into the project cycle and higher-level decision-making, fostering ongoing improvement.

Effective Solutions

Since its inception in 2021, it has received 32 grievances from a diverse range of stakeholders, including women, men, neighbors, workers, elderly individuals, community leaders, and civil society representatives. 



The concerns raised have covered various topics such as land acquisition, working conditions, noise pollution, structural damage to houses, and lack of communication and engagement.

The mechanism has successfully addressed numerous grievances, demonstrating its effectiveness in problem-solving and risk management. 

For instance, a community grievance regarding noise pollution by a retail company led to a series of measures to reorganize the retail logistics and, therefore, significantly reduce the impact on neighbors.  

Another case involved improving accessibility, dissemination, and effectiveness of the company's internal workers' mechanism based on feedback received from a complaint.

Access and Expectation

Stakeholders can submit grievances in all languages and formats.

Each grievance will be addressed in a tailored fashion, focused on the complainants' needs and the projects' context.

After assessing the issues, solutions will be developed in close collaboration with the clients. To ensure they are implemented promptly, IDB Invest will monitor them closely.

While not a requirement, complainants are encouraged to contact the client's project-level mechanism, which will identify and address potential issues of concern at the local level.

Transparency and Confidentiality

IDB Invest is committed to maintaining transparency and confidentiality throughout the grievance process. 

Information on IDB Invest projects is publicly available, and stakeholders can submit grievances through online forms or by contacting the relevant offices via email, letter, or telephone. 

The mechanism ensures that all personal information is kept confidential and that any situation posing a risk to life, health, safety, or the environment is promptly addressed.

When fear of retaliation is present, grievances will be handled with due consideration and confidentiality.

The Management Grievance Mechanism at IDB Invest exemplifies the organization’s dedication to addressing environmental and social concerns through effective problem-solving, risk management, and continuous learning. 

By providing a structured process for handling grievances, the MGM resolves issues and contributes to the sustainable development of projects and the well-being of communities.
